The manual for the D7 says exactly what you have experienced.

 

2.2w on 6V, 5w on 9.6v and 6w on 13.8v

Hey folks,

 

A while ago the battery pack on my D7 died completely, so I headed into
andrews to get a new one..  Turned out he had the kenwood 4-AA box in stock,
so I went with that instead, after being assured that the difference between
my 9.6v high-capacity pack, and the 6v 4xAA pack wouldn't effect my power
out...  Although having bought one of the little digitor 30W VHF amps off
ebay yesterday, I find that on battery, the D7 is only putting out about 3W,
where was on external DC, it's putting out the full 5W.. - Anyone else gone
from a 'proper' pack to one of the AA packs?  And seen something similar?
Doesn't bother me hugely, as I pretty much always use it off the car power,
but thought it was a bit strange..
